Myanmar, formerly known as Burma, has been a country plagued by conflicts and turmoil throughout its history. In recent years, the military coup in February 2021 has led to widespread human rights abuses, violence, and a deteriorating humanitarian situation in the country. As the people of Myanmar continue to fight for democracy and freedom, advocacy efforts have emerged across the globe, including in the heart of Europe – Warsaw, Poland. Warsaw, the capital city of Poland, has become a hub for advocacy and support for the people of Myanmar. The Polish government, along with non-profit organizations, activists, and concerned citizens, have come together to raise awareness and provide assistance to those affected by the crisis in Myanmar. One of the key advocacy initiatives in Warsaw is to bring attention to the human rights violations in Myanmar and to call for international intervention to support the people's struggle for democracy. Through protests, social media campaigns, and lobbying efforts, activists in Warsaw are working tirelessly to amplify the voices of the people of Myanmar and to pressure governments and international organizations to take action. Additionally, fundraising events, educational seminars, and cultural exchanges are being organized in Warsaw to support humanitarian efforts in Myanmar. From collecting donations for affected communities to hosting art exhibitions showcasing the rich cultural heritage of Myanmar, the people of Warsaw are showing solidarity and standing in solidarity with their brothers and sisters in Myanmar.
